Following its introduction during SHOT Show 2011, Kahr Arms displayed the newest in its series of pistols, the CM9. Sporting Kahr's 7 patented features, the CM9 is a 9 mm-chambered DAO pistol designed for concealed carry. The CM9 has a 3-inch barrel, is less than an inch wide and weighs 14 ozs. unloaded, attributable to its polymer frame and extremely small profile. The magazine capacity is 6 rounds. Though not mentioned in the video below, Kahr also showed the requisite enthusiasm for the M1911 centennial by introducing a 100th Anniversary 1911 pistol of its own through its Auto-Ordnance brand. The anniversary pistols come with parkerized finishes, and are available in 3 different configurations: a traditional unmarked slide, a specially engraved edition and a traditional version with wood grips.
